$ZEC and $XRP are showing strength. But is altseason really starting?
I’d be careful with that conclusion.
The important signal isn’t two coins outperforming. It’s whether capital starts rotating across a wider part of the altcoin market.
#BTC ’s pullback after stronger U.S. jobs data adds another layer to the move, with higher Treasury yields putting pressure on risk assets.
So the real test from here is simple:
Does the strength broaden?
More altcoins outperforming BTC + stronger volume + deeper liquidity would make the rotation much more convincing.

A major decentralization move is happening on Terra Classic.
DutchLUNC, one of the largest validators on the network, has redelegated 63 BILLION $LUNC across 21 validators.
The tokens were distributed in batches of 3B LUNC per validator, spreading a massive amount of delegated stake across the ecosystem.
The bigger picture?
Validator concentration matters.
By distributing stake across more validators, Terra Classic can move toward a more balanced validator landscape, stronger participation and greater resilience.

Alts/Others market cap just broke out of its multi-day range and back above $200 billion.
It spent more than a week stuck between $188B support and $198B resistance. That upper line just got taken out.
Next resistance: $210B.
A clean hold above $200B keeps the short-term structure bullish. Lose $198B and it falls back into the range.
This is the first real expansion move in alts after weeks of sideways action. Bitcoin has been leading. Now the broader market is trying to follow.
